Yes DJ this is true, but with trying to rent a place you have a lot to cover with this also. Theres the clean up of thousands of bbs, damage coverage of the property, and of course a HUGE insurance bond along with that you may need an attorney to go over the lease to make sure it's all as tight as a frogs a$$. Not trying to discourage you, but like Matt has pointed out and as being a owner of a airsoft field, this sport is a phony pony if you don't have huge $$$$$$ to do everything on your own. That is why renting another filed with them already doing all the leg work is sometimes the way to go. GOOD LUCK!!! and I hope it all works out for you.
